  • How do you keep food warm during a tailgate?

    If you’re transporting hot food, use foil trays and wrap them with towels or double-wrap them in foil. Use a cooler to store the hot food as it will trap the heat and keep the food hot. Always keep raw foods like meats and poultry separate from cooked perishable and nonperishable foods.

    Who has the best tailgate?

    A recent study used more than 200,000 tweets to track tailgating activity of fans of all National Football League (NFL) teams and found that Cleveland Browns fans are the #1 tailgaters in the nation. Division rivals Buffalo Bills ranked just behind Cleveland, while fans of the Pittsburgh Steelers were ranked 5th.

  • How do you keep food warm for hours?

    Slow Cooker or Chafing Dishes For hot vegetables, sauces, stews, and soups, a slow cooker or chafing dish may be used on the low setting to keep the food warm. Similar to an oven, if you plan to store foods for longer than an hour, you may notice a change in texture or taste.

    How do you keep food warm while transporting?

    Use common sense when keeping food warm for transporting and you should be fine.

  • Wrap In Aluminum Foil and Towels.
  • Use A Hard Cooler.
  • Use a Soft Cooler.
  • Add Hot Water Bottles, Heat Packs or Hot Bricks.
  • Use a Portable 12V Food Warmer.
  • Use an Insulated Thermos.
  • Use a Thermal Cooker.
  • Use Thermal Bags.
